Bitcoin ETF Outflows Hit $6B as Tech Stock Weakness Pressures BTC Price

24 Jun 2026 · 10:55 UTC · Coinspeaker RSS Feed · Original source

Read original at Coinspeaker RSS Feed

Summary

Record $6 billion in Bitcoin ETF outflows are pressuring Bitcoin prices lower, pushing BTC to a two-week low of $62,546. The outflows coincide with a sharp 7.9% decline in the semiconductor index, reflecting broader risk-off market sentiment. This combination of institutional selling and macro headwinds suggests continued near-term weakness for Bitcoin and potentially steeper declines for altcoins, as alternative cryptocurrencies are more sensitive to growth-stock volatility.

Why it matters

The article highlights two mechanically significant drivers: (1) record ETF outflows directly reduce institutional demand for Bitcoin, creating selling pressure, and (2) semiconductor weakness signals risk-off sentiment propagating to crypto markets. ETF outflows mechanistically liquidate holdings in real-time, explaining elevated near-term volatility. Semiconductor index decline reflects macro uncertainty and flight-to-safety behavior, which extends to cryptocurrencies as risk assets. Altcoins exhibit higher beta to this sentiment given lower institutional adoption and tighter correlation with growth stocks.
